The St. Joe Company has recently released its quarterly financial results for the period ending June 30, 2025. The figures showcase key developments in both its revenue generation and expense management across its real estate segments. Below are the highlights from the income statement and notable operational aspects.
- Revenue: Total revenue for Q2 2025 rose to $129.1 million, a 15.7% increase from $111.6 million in Q2 2024.
- Net Income: The company reported net income of $29.5 million for Q2 2025, up 20.4% from $24.5 million in Q2 2024.
- Real Estate Revenue: Increased 27.0% to $43.8 million during Q2 2025, attributed to a 21.0% rise in homesite closings to 225.
- Hospitality Revenue: Grew by 10.4% to a record $68.8 million due to increased membership dues and operations.
- Leasing Revenue: Saw an increase of 11.5% to $16.5 million, setting a quarterly record for the segment.
Expenses Overview:
- Total Expenses: Increased by 15.3% to $92.1 million in Q2 2025 from $79.0 million in Q2 2024.
- Cost of Real Estate Revenue: Increased by 43.4% to $23.8 million, reflecting higher development costs associated with increased revenue.
- Hospitality Costs: Rose to $42.3 million, a 11.9% increase from last year, impacted by operational costs.
- Net Interest Expense: Decreased by 8.2% to $7.8 million, owing to lower interest rates following debt repayments.
Financial Health Indicators:
- Earnings Per Share: Boosted to $0.51 for Q2 2025 from $0.42 year-over-year.
- Investment in Real Estate: Increased slightly to $1.05 billion from $1.04 billion at year-end 2024.
- Cash Position: Cash and cash equivalents stood at $88.2 million at the end of Q2 2025, compared to $88.8 million as of December 31, 2024.
- Total Debt: Decreased to $427.3 million from $437.8 million at year-end 2024.
Market and Operational Context:
- No significant increases in cancellation rates for homebuilders have been reported, indicating stable demand within the markets.
- In Q2 2025, St. Joe continued proactive resource management through joint ventures to enhance its operational efficiencies.
While the income statement reflects several positive aspects such as increased revenues and net income, there are concerns regarding rising expenses, particularly in the real estate and hospitality segments, along with the broader negative impact of macroeconomic factors. Nevertheless, the expansion of operations in Northwest Florida positions St. Joe well for sustained growth moving forward.
